What Is a Diagnostic Scan?

A diagnostic scan uses specialized tools and a professional diagnostic scanner to access your vehicle’s modules and systems. These tools connect to the Controller Area Network, also known as the CAN bus, allowing technicians to read data, fault codes, and diagnostic trouble codes stored within the system.

Understanding Vehicle Computer Systems

Modern cars are built around multiple systems that depend on communication between modules. These vehicle modules include the engine control module, ABS module, transmission control, and safety systems. Each module collects data from sensors and shares that data across communication lines. The CAN bus allows modules to transmit data efficiently so systems can respond in real time.

What a Professional Scan Actually Checks

A professional diagnostic process checks fault codes, monitors live data, and evaluates real-time data from sensors. It verifies communication between modules and identifies communication errors or communication loss. It also checks power and ground connections, wiring integrity, and signal accuracy. The scanner helps determine whether the issue lies in a specific module, faulty sensors, or other components. This process verifies system health before any effective repair begins.

What Are Sensor Faults in Modern Vehicles?

Sensors play a critical role in modern vehicles. They collect data about engine performance, speed, braking, and environmental conditions. When sensors fail, multiple systems can be affected.

Common Sensors That Fail

Faulty sensors can include oxygen sensors, wheel speed sensors, radar sensors, and steering sensors. These sensors feed data into vehicle modules like the engine control module and ABS module. When a sensor fails, it can disrupt communication and lead to performance issues.

Signs of Sensor Issues

Common signs include warning lights, check engine alerts, and error messages displayed on the dashboard. You may also notice performance changes such as reduced fuel efficiency, rough idling, or inconsistent braking. In some cases, a no-start condition can occur.

Why Sensor Issues Are Not Always Obvious

Not all faulty sensors trigger warning lights. Some intermittent issues only appear under certain conditions. Without proper diagnostics and testing, these problems can be missed. That is why diagnostic tools and a scanner are essential to verify system behavior and identify the root cause.

Understanding Module Communication Faults (U-Codes)

Module communication is essential for modern cars to function correctly. When communication breaks down, it leads to communication errors stored as diagnostic trouble codes.

What Are Communication Errors?

Communication errors occur when vehicle modules fail to communicate across the CAN bus or Controller Area Network. These errors can result from wiring problems, damaged connectors, or software faults. A communication loss can impact multiple systems at once.

Common Causes of Communication Failures

Common causes include wiring issues, physical damage from a collision, water intrusion, and damaged connectors. Electrical faults such as an open circuit or short circuit can disrupt communication lines. Poor ground connections or low lines can also affect signal quality.

Real World Example

After a collision, the ABS module may lose communication with other modules. Even if the component appears intact, the issue lies in disrupted communication lines. This can affect safety systems and braking performance. Diagnostic tools help determine the exact moment a fault occurred using freeze frame data.

Why Diagnostic Scans Are Critical After a Collision

After an accident, hidden damage can affect sensors, modules, and communication systems. Diagnostic scans are essential for identifying these issues.

Hidden Damage You Cannot See

Collisions can damage wiring, sensors, and vehicle modules without visible signs. This can lead to communication errors and performance issues that go unnoticed.

Pre-Repair Scans

A pre-scan is the first step in the diagnostic process. It identifies fault codes, captures freeze frame data, and helps determine the root cause of any issue. This ensures that no components are replaced unnecessarily.

Post-Repair Scans

After repairs, a post-scan verifies that all systems are functioning correctly. It confirms that communication has been restored and that no fault codes remain. Clearing codes is only done after the issue is resolved.

The Role of ADAS in Diagnostic Scanning

Advanced Driver Assistance Systems depend on accurate sensor data and precise communication between modules.

What Is ADAS?

ADAS includes safety systems like lane assist, adaptive cruise control, and collision avoidance. These systems rely on sensors and vehicle modules working together.

Why ADAS Systems Require Precision

Even small alignment issues can disrupt signal accuracy. This can lead to performance changes and reduced effectiveness of safety systems.

How Diagnostic Scans Support Calibration

Diagnostic tools verify sensor alignment and module communication before and after calibration. This ensures that all systems communicate properly and perform as intended.

Frequently Asked Questions

Do diagnostic scans check for sensor and module communication faults?

Yes, diagnostic scans are specifically designed to detect communication errors, faulty sensors, and issues within vehicle modules.

What are diagnostic trouble codes?

Diagnostic trouble codes are fault codes stored in vehicle modules when a fault occurs. They help identify the root cause of issues.

How does a diagnostic scanner work?

A diagnostic scanner connects to the CAN bus and reads data from vehicle modules. It displays fault codes, live data, and system status.

Can diagnostics detect intermittent issues?

Yes, diagnostics use freeze frame data and real-time data to identify intermittent issues and performance changes.

Why is the check engine light important?

The check engine light indicates that a fault has been detected. It is one of the most important warning lights and should never be ignored.

What happens during the diagnostic process?

The process includes scanning for fault codes, testing systems, verifying communication, and analyzing data to determine the root cause.
